This has really started to bother me as of recent...

Since I'm still a couple of months away from getting a processor upgrade, I'm running on my G4 400.
Video card is a Radeon 8500, and I've got 896mb of memory.
When I go to watch a flash cartoon with Firefox, the audio plays smoothly, but the video gets stuck, takes a few seconds to catch up, goes and then repeats through the whole file.
In Safari, the playback is *almost* flawless.

Normally, I wouldn't worry about it, but I much prefer firefox right now to Safari. Anybody know what's going on? Is it just the programming? Does anyone else experience the same thing?
